I have 3 sightrons the lens are excellent.
One problem in the past was holding zero. {mushey clicks}
Some pepole had screws put in to help it hold zero.
Warrenty work is ok like the weavers.

The Sightron SIII 8-32x56 I've got on one of my LR prone rifles is infinitely clearer, sharper, & brighter than any of the 36x BR scopes that were available 15-20yrs. ago. Tracking/repeatability has also been excellent.

Personally, I don't feel the need for more power than this scope provides, although there are plenty of shooters who're obviously willing to pay the price to get into a NF 12-42. Right now Sightron is at the top of list. Clicked anywhere from 30 MOA to 20 MOA many times today then back to 0. Rifle was still dead on,scope bounced around all day in my truck.

FWIW- The 6x24 Sightron SIII LR has 100 minutes of elevation, a fair amount more than the 8x32 depending on what distances you plan to shoot
